The 24th G8 Summit was held in Birmingham, England, United Kingdom on 15–17 May 1998. The venue for this summit meeting was the International Convention Centre, Birmingham. The Group of Seven (G7) was an unofficial forum which brought together the heads of the richest industrialized countries: France, Germany, Italy, Japan, the United Kingdom, the United States and Canada starting in 1976. The G8, meeting for the first time in 1997, was formed with the addition of Russia. In addition, the President of the European Commission has been formally included in summits since 1981. The summits were not meant to be linked formally with wider international institutions; and in fact, a mild rebellion against the stiff formality of other international meetings was a part of the genesis of cooperation

  • Der G8-Gipfel in Birmingham 1998 war das 24. Gipfeltreffen der Regierungschefs der Gruppe der Acht. Das Treffen fand unter dem Vorsitz des britischen Premierminister Tony Blair vom 15. bis 17. Mai 1998 statt. Bei diesem Treffen wurde Russland formal als Teilnehmer der G8 aufgenommen. Während des Gipfeltreffens pflanzte jeder der acht teilnehmenden Staats- bzw. Regierungschefs im St Thomas’ Peace Garden einen Baum, der sein jeweiliges Herkunftsland repräsentieren sollte. (de)
